1992-08-27 Regular Meeting Building Commission Beverly Public Library August 27, 1992 Present: John Coogan, Neil Olson, John Quinn. Also present: Thomas Scully, Sheila Glowacki, William Capone, Keith Hoffses. John Coogan presided. John Quinn moved that the minutes of the previous meeting be accepted. Motion passed. Report of the Architect: 1) According to a report from H.B. Smith the boiler is repairable. This report has been forwarded to GOldberg with a request for a price to do the work. 2) The extra marble slabs are being disposed of by TLT. 3) Concerning restoration - TLT removed the marble from the rear of the building which was deeply imbedded, and severely nicked and goudged it to the point of making it unusable. Also the base plates are rusted. So what the architect suggested is to leave the big pieces of marble alone and repair the cracks in front of the building. Base plate can be repaired by taking the brick out and sandblasting. During reroofing water proofing will be done on top of walls' to prevent water from seeping behind. Repointing will be done in front of building. Keith suggested that they investigate with their preservation consultant qualified contractors who can do the work and negotiate a fair and equitable price. The preservation consultant wants to be compensated for evaluating the damaged marble and rewriting specifications to modify the original restoration plans. Neil Olson moved to authorize the architect to engage the restoration architect to evaluate damage and to proceed with the new plan of restoration. Motion passed. 4) TLT wants $4,000. to reconnect lighting in the skylights. It was decided to decline their offer and find someone else to do it later. 5) Concerning the misalignment of the floor, the architect stated that it is the contractor's responsibility to build the building correctly and that TLT should bear all expense of rectifying the problem. After weighing all options, the architect recommended that the floor in the old building be raised to meet the level of the new addition. Neil Olson moved to proceed with corrective proceedures as outlined by the architect. Motion passed. Report of the Clerk of the Works: 1) Mass Electric is going to put the vault and transformers in at no cost to us. They are looking for an easement on our property to put the vault. There would be two switchboxes above the ground. In order for them to order their equipment they must have permission in writing from the Board of Aldermen. Neil Olson moved that the Commission support Mass Electric in their request for an easement on library for the described electrical service. Motion passed. 2) The following work has been done to date: Ground floor laid, elevator shaft started, enclosure for bookmobile and van started, brickwork started, windows have arrived, duct and sprinkler work is 90% completed, stairs started, one side of plaza is poured, plumbing and electrical work is 70% finished.
